Recliner repair services involve addressing issues related to the functionality, comfort, and appearance of reclining chairs. Technicians assess the condition of the recliner’s mechanical components, upholstery, and frame to identify problems such as broken or worn-out reclining mechanisms, sagging cushions, torn fabric, or damaged hardware. The goal is to restore the chair’s proper operation and aesthetic appeal, ensuring it functions smoothly and looks presentable. This process often includes replacing or repairing faulty parts, tightening loose components, and restoring the upholstery to improve the overall comfort and durability of the recliner.

Many common problems lead property owners to seek recliner repair services. These issues include malfunctioning reclining mechanisms that prevent the chair from adjusting properly, broken or bent metal parts, and worn-out or torn fabric that affects both the appearance and comfort. Additionally, some recliners develop squeaking noises or become unstable due to loose joints or damaged hardware. Repair services help resolve these problems, extending the life of the furniture and maintaining its functionality. The overview below groups typical Recliner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Albuquerque, NM.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- Typically, the cost for recliner repair labor ranges from $75 to $200, depending on the complexity of the fix. For example, replacing a recliner mechanism may cost around $100 to $150 in local service areas. Prices vary based on the repair's scope and the provider.

Parts Replacement - Replacement parts such as motors, springs, or fabric can add $50 to $300 to the overall cost. A motor replacement might be approximately $100 to $200, while fabric reupholstery could range from $150 to $300, depending on material and size.

Service Call Fees - Many local pros charge a service call fee between $50 and $100. This fee often covers the technician’s assessment and initial diagnostics before any repairs are performed.

Total Repair Costs - Overall, the total expense for recliner repair services generally falls between $100 and $500. The final cost depends on the specific repairs needed and the parts involved, with some minor fixes costing less and extensive repairs reaching higher amounts.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
